Global $75.03 Bn Automotive Thermal Management Market by Technology, Vehicle Type, Application and Geography - Forecast to 2026 - ResearchAndMarkets.com

The "Automotive Thermal Management - Global Market Outlook (2017-2026)" report has been added to ResearchAndMarkets.com's offering.

According to the report, the Global Automotive Thermal Management Market accounted for $50.83 billion in 2017 and is expected to reach $75.03 billion by 2026 growing at a CAGR of 4.4% from 2017 to 2026.

Increased stringency in emission regulation to upsurge the fuel economy, rising demand for comfort features, advancement in mobility solutions and need for power extension to uplift the thermal management market are some of the key factors propelling the market growth. However, factors such as high cost of thermal system technology are restricting the market growth.

By geography, Asia Pacific will be the major contributor to the global market and this will mainly be attributed to factors such as the large population and the growth of local vendors who supply cost-effective spares. The availability of various automobile segments owing to the improving per capita income and the abundant supply of raw materials that make the region a low-cost market for automobiles and parts, will also drive the growth prospects of this market in Asia Pacific.
